Romford
Town
Photo: MRSC, Public domain.
Romford is a large town in east London, England, located 14 mi northeast of Charing Cross. Part of the London Borough of Havering, the town is one of the major metropolitan centres of Greater London identified in the London Plan.
Rush Green
Locality
Photo: MRSC, Public domain.
Rush Green is a suburban area in Romford in East London, England. It straddles the boundary of the London Borough of Barking and Dagenham and the London Borough of Havering, and is located 13.5 miles east-northeast of Charing Cross.
Gidea Park
Suburb
Photo: Trevor Harris,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Gidea Park is a neighbourhood in the east of Romford and Hornchurch in the London Borough of Havering, south-east England. Predominantly an affluent and residential area, it was historically located in the county of Essex.
